Output fbd5070565793bcd1319ca240fefdd51683013a0c945115d923569320ac0ac26:4

value
13780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82cd0d60aecb9a505622fb5ff228049fa2299c36 OP_EQUAL
address
3DcdQmAWD2ebnUnJBb4jTahh3VnQpqDbyU
transaction
fbd5070565793bcd1319ca240fefdd51683013a0c945115d923569320ac0ac26
spent
true